Application
Sodium cyclopentadienylide is a useful reagent for the preparation of metallocenes and cyclopentadienyl metal complexes.
It can also be used in the synthesis of:
- Ruthenocene and fullerene molecular hybrid, Ru(η5- C60Me5)( η5-C5H5) (bucky ruthenocene).
- Allyl-substituted cyclopentadiene by palladium-catalyzed allylic alkylation.
- Bis(cyclopentadienyl)zirconium dichloride which is used as a catalyst in the synthesis of bis(indolyl)methanes and alkylation of heteroaryls.
- Cp-cobaltacycles from diphenylphosphinoalkynes and CoCl(PPh3)3.
